> The itemize white space issue was a difference in handling \reference. In 
> mkii a \reference between \startitemize and the first item did not produce 
> empty space, in mkiv it does. I moved the \reference to inside the \item

For numbered items you can use the optional argument of \item to set a 
reference.

\starttext

\startitemize[n]
\item[item:one] First item
\item[item:two] Second item
\stopitemize

\page

Take a look at \in{item}[item:two] on \at{page}[item:two].

\stoptext
